11. What is the bumble bee lives-years? Bumble bee queens overwinter within the crushed for the short cavities (always from inside the decaying wood otherwise significantly less than sagging crushed and you will mulch). From inside the spring these types of queens arise, try to find a nest site right after which begin foraging having pollen and you may nectar. Colony internet sites might be significantly more than surface in tall grass otherwise between man-generated structures including cinder stops otherwise underground when you look at the quit rodent burrows. Queens up coming run installing eggs and you will rearing the woman developing young. Once her basic eggs appear due to the fact people, these types of bees serve as the woman worker bees, event the fresh pollen and you will nectar and giving the new brood because the foundress lives in the fresh colony and lies much more egg. The brand new colony is growing from june. Once the june wanes this new colony changes out of promoting worker bees so you can producing the fresh queens and you may males (also referred to as drones). This new queens and you will guys exit brand new nest to find mates away from other colonies. At the conclusion of the season, new bumble-bee colony dies out of, for instance the foundress king, pros and you can males. Only the the fresh new queens get a hold of a location to spend winter, doing the new course.

15. What’s a cuckoo bumble bee? Cuckoo bumble bees try nest parasitic organisms away from most other bumble bee kinds. It appear after and you will in the place of founding their own colony, cuckoo bees usurp brand new colony and you may displace the new king of another types. Ladies cuckoo bumble bees have a dense exoskeleton, also effective mandibles and you will stinger, that make him or her burdensome for brand new foundress king in order to reduce the chances of.
